Registered Nurse will be responsible for the following on an as needed basis:
- Statewide nursing consultations and trainings for customers in the Community Supports Department.
- Determine the designated care aide, under the direction of a competent adult or caretaker, can safely perform the required activities in the minor child's or adult's home.
- Perform health maintenance activities that are not exempted by the Consumer Directed Care Act of 2005, to include:
- Physical, psychological, and social assessment which requires nursing judgment, intervention, referral, or follow-up;
- Formulation of the plan of nursing care and evaluation of the client's response to the care rendered; Tasks that require nursing judgment or intervention;
- Teaching and health counseling;
- Administration of any injectable medications (intradermal, subcutaneous, intramuscular, intravenous, intraosseous, or any other form of injection) or intravenous therapy.
- Receiving or transmitting verbal or telephone orders.
